Overview
With  a  record  high  33,000  US  
opioid-­related  deaths  in  2015  –
and  numbers  that  are  steadily  
increasing  – it’s  a  problem  that  
isn’t  going  away  soon.
Opioid  Epidemic
“The  use  of  prescription  and  
non-­prescription  opioids  –
including  Percocet,  Vicodin,  
Oxycodone,  OxyContin,  and  
fentanyl  – has  reached  
epidemic  proportions  in  the  
United  States.”
-­ Drug  Enforcement  Administration  
(DEA)

Use  Case:  The  State  of  Indiana
Using  Data  as  an  Innovative  Approach
12WEBINAR Disrupting  the  Opioid  Epidemic  with  Data  Analytics
ksmconsulting.com©  2017  KSM  Consulting,  LLC
What  is  being  done  to  
combat  the  epidemic?
Use  Case:  The  State  of  Indiana
Indiana  reports  a  500%  increase  
in  opioid  overdoses  since  1999.  
13WEBINAR Disrupting  the  Opioid  Epidemic  with  Data  Analytics
ksmconsulting.com©  2017  KSM  Consulting,  LLC
Use  Case:  
The  State  of  Indiana
• Goal:  Create  a  coordinated,  thoughtful  
response  to  the  drug  epidemic  that  
addresses  it  from  all  important  
perspectives.
• Long  View:  Implement  the  most  effective  
treatments  and  preventions  for  the  
citizens  that  need  them  most.
Drug  Task  Force  includes  a  
variety  of  different  local  leaders:
• Law  enforcement  officials
• Public  health  administrators
• Emergency  response  and  
treatment  professionals
• And  more.
Creation  of  Governor’s  Task  Force

Outcomes  Overview
• Optimized  locations  for  new  opioid  overdose  
treatment  centers
• Identified  how  to  efficiently  deploy  Naloxone  to  
create  the  largest  impact
• Provided  insight  into  drug  abuse  trends  to  
provide  targeted  help  where  needed  most
• Uncovered  other  crime  factors  previously  
unseen,  such  as  a  growing  trend  in  pharmacy  
employee  pilferage
Use  Case:  
The  State  of  Indiana

Key  Enabling  Technology  Advancements
• Lab  test  standardization:  cleaning  and  standardizing  
results  from  different  testing  labs  so  that  they  can  be  
evaluated  concurrently.
• Death  record  standardization: unlocking  the  valuable  
information  trapped  in  death  record  narrative  enabling  
deep  evaluation  of  actual  cause  of  death.
• Probabilistic  record  linkage:  enabling  merging  of  
disparate  data  sets  even  when  data  quality  problems  exist.
• Foundational  data:  domain-­specific  data  to  ground  
analytical  models  and  enable  appropriate  response.
19WEBINAR Disrupting  the  Opioid  Epidemic  with  Data  Analytics
ksmconsulting.com©  2017  KSM  Consulting,  LLC
Key  Advancements  Underway
Proactive  Flags
To  effectively  address  the  problem  in  
real  time,  algorithms  to  identify  at-­risk  
patients  based  on  historical  data  are  
being  developed.
Program  and  Service  
Efficacy  Analysis
Deploying  resources  in  a  coordinated  
fashion  as  efficiently  as  possible  is  
vital  to  combat  the  problem.
Other
Additional  data  is  constantly  being  
added  to  the  application  and  existing  
functionality  is  being  iteratively  
improved.
Drug-­Level  Predictions
Drug-­level  historical  information  and  
predictions  are  being  generated.

Use  Case:  The  State  of  Indiana
Situation
Currently  the  State  of  Indiana  has  
13  active  opioid  treatment  centers  
and  were  granted  the  ability  to  add  
five  additional  programs.
Solution
By  analyzing  the  data,  the  team  
identified:  where  the  greatest  need  for  
treatments  centers  was;;  which  
programs  were  overcapacity;;  and
where  the  five  new  centers  would  be  
most  effective
Challenge
Determine  where  the  treatment  
centers  were  most  needed  
throughout  the  State

Funding  Opportunities
SAMHSA  Opioid  STR  Grant  (R21/R33)
Agency:  National  Institutes  of  Health
Funding  Available:  $2,000,000  ($200,000  award  
ceiling)
Deadline:  June  20,  2017
Application  of  Funding:  The  purpose  of  this  FOA  is  
to  solicit  applications  proposing  to  test  approaches  for  
expanding  medication  assisted  treatment  (MAT)  for  
opioid  use  disorders  (OUD)  in  the  general  health  care  
sector  or  linking  individuals  with  OUDS  who  receive  
naloxone  for  the  reversal  of  overdose  to  MAT  in  the  
context  of  stats  plans  for  use  of  the  fund.
Rural  Access  to  Emergency  Devices  
Opioid  Overdose  Reversal  Grant
Agency:  Health  Resources  and  Services  
Administration
Funding  Available:  $10,000,000  (no  limit;;  30  awards)
Deadline:  N/A
Application  of  Funding:  The  purpose  of  this  program  
is  to  reduce  the  incidences  of  morbidity  and  mortality  
related  to  opioid  overdoses  in  rural  communities  
through  the  purchase  and  placement  of  emergency  
devices  used  to  rapidly  reverse  the  effects  of  opioid  
overdoses  and  training  of  licensed  healthcare  
professionals  and  emergency  responders  on  their  use.

Funding  Opportunities
Clinical  Evaluation  of  Adjuncts  to  Opioid  Therapies  
for  the  Treatment  of  Chronic  Pain  (R01)
Agency:  National  Institutes  of  Health
Deadline:  January  7,  2018
Application  of  Funding:  This  aims  to  fund  
applications  designed  to  assess  the  clinical  value  of  
adjuncts  prescribed  to  chronic  pain  patients  together  
with  opioid  analgesics.  Adjuncts  of  interest  are  either  
approved  by  the  FDA  or  have  previously  been  studied  
as  an  Investigational  New  Drug.  Studies  with  adjuncts  
of  interest  should  be  focused  on  enhancing  analgesia,  
rather  than  on  reducing  an  adverse  effect.  A  secondary  
purpose  is  to  increase  awareness  among  opioid  
prescribers  of  the  potential  value  of  adjunctive  
therapies  by  focused  data  dissemination.
NIDA  Translational  Avant-­Garde  Award  for  Development  
of  Medication  to  Treat  Substance  Use  Disorders  
(UG3/UH3)
Agency:  National  Institutes  of  Health
Funding  Available:  $2,000,000  ($1,000,000  award  ceiling;;  2  
awards)
Deadline:  May  7,  2020
Application  of  Funding:  This  award  is  to  support  
outstanding  basic  and/or  clinical  researchers  with  the  vision  
and  expertise  to  translate  research  discoveries  into  
medications  for  the  treatment  of  Substance  Use  Disorders  
(SUDs)  stemming  from  tobacco,  cannabis,  cocaine,  
methamphetamine,  heroin,  or  prescription  opiate  use.  Eligible  
applicants  must  demonstrate  the  ability  to  develop  molecules  
with  the  potential  to  treat  SUDs  and  advance  them  in  the  
drug  development  continuum.  The  ultimate  goal  is  to  bring  
molecules  closer  to  FDA  approval.
